( 1 ) THE above noted writ petition No. 22657 of 1991 has been filed by Shri Ram Chandra mission, Shahjahanpur, through its Secretary Shri B. D. Mahajan under Article 226 of the constitution of India, challenging the validity and legality of the action of the respondent Nos. 2 and 3 namely, the Registrar of Firms, Societies and Chits U. P. Lucknow and the Assistant registrar of Firms, Societies and Chits, Bareilly Region, Bareilly, refusing to recognise the working Committee of the petitioner Shri Ram Chandra Mission (hereinafter referred to as the petitioner) headed by Dr. S. P. Srivastava, President and Shri B. D. Mahajan, as Secretary. A writ of mandamus has been sought directing the respondents No. 2 and 3 to recognise the Working committee of the petitioner Mission as per the order passed under Section 25 of the Societies registration Act, 1860, by the Prescribed Authority and, further to grant a fresh certificate of renewal for registration to the petitioner.
